Convocations Will Open 2009-10 Academic Year at Rider
The 2009-10 academic year at Rider University will get under way in September with three traditional ceremonies to welcome back faculty, staff and students to its Lawrenceville and Princeton campuses.
The Lawrenceville Campus Fall 2009 Opening Convocation will be held on Thursday, September 3, at 2 p.m., in the Cavalla Room, inside the Bart Luedeke Center. A backyard reception to honor new faculty and staff will take place immediately afterward at the President’s House, opposite Lawrenceville Road from Rider. Lawrenceville’s New Student Convocation will take place on Tuesday, September 8, in the SRC at 1 p.m. This hour-long ceremony welcomes new students as members of the Rider community. The Westminster Choir College Fall 2009 Opening Convocation will be held on Tuesday, September 8, at 4:30 p.m., in Bristol Chapel, on Westminster’s Princeton campus. In addition to the opening address, featured performances will include the world premiere of Professor Ronald A. Hemmel’s An Idle Rhyme, a setting of a text by Ella Wheeler Wilcox for choir and piano.
